Definitions

  1. to enlighten; to guide
  2. to employ
  3. to implement; to put into practice
  4. to follow; to comply
  5. to advance; to progress
  6. Short for 迪斯科 (dísīkē, “disco”).
    /    tīng   discotheque
  7. A surname.
